How to Transition from Passive Scrolling to an Active Reading Habit in the Digital Age

In today's fast-paced digital world, it's all too easy to fall into the habit of passive scrolling through social media feeds, news articles, and endless streams of content. While it can be entertaining, this passive consumption often leaves us feeling unfulfilled and mentally drained. If you're looking to cultivate a more rewarding relationship with information, transitioning to an active reading habit is essential. Here's how to make that shift effectively.

Identify Your Motivation

Understanding why you want to read more actively is the first step in making a change. Consider the following:

  • Personal Growth: Are you interested in expanding your knowledge or skills in a particular area?
  • Mental Stimulation: Do you seek to engage your mind more deeply rather than allowing it to wander aimlessly?
  • Enjoyment : Perhaps you simply want to rediscover the joy of reading for pleasure.

By identifying your motivation, you can create a clear vision of what you want to achieve, which will help sustain your commitment.

Set Clear Goals

Establishing specific goals can provide direction and a sense of accomplishment as you transition from passive scrolling to active reading:

  • Daily Reading Targets : Aim for a certain number of pages, chapters, or time spent reading each day. Start small---perhaps 10 to 15 minutes---and gradually increase as you build the habit.
  • Diverse Reading List : Curate a list of books, articles, or essays that excite you. Include a mix of genres and topics to keep things interesting and cater to different moods.

Create a Reading-Friendly Environment

Your surroundings can greatly influence your ability to focus and engage with reading material. Here are some tips to foster a conducive environment:

  • Designate a Reading Space : Choose a comfortable spot free from distractions where you can sit down with your book or digital device. This space should be inviting and associated with positive reading experiences.
  • Limit Digital Distractions : During your reading sessions, silence notifications, and remove tempting distractions like social media apps from your immediate view. Consider using apps that block distracting websites during set reading periods.

Incorporate Active Reading Techniques

Active reading involves engaging with the text rather than passively consuming it. Use these techniques to enhance your reading experience:

  • Take Notes : Jot down key points, questions, or insights as you read. This practice not only reinforces comprehension but also makes it easier to revisit important concepts later.
  • Ask Questions : Before, during, and after reading, pose questions about the material. What is the author trying to convey? How does this relate to what you already know? Engaging with the text critically fosters deeper understanding.
  • Summarize and Reflect : After finishing a section or chapter, take a moment to summarize what you've read in your own words. Reflect on how it connects to your personal experiences or other readings.

Replace Passive Consumption with Intentional Reading

To truly transition into an active reading habit, it's crucial to replace passive scrolling with purposeful reading:

  • Schedule Reading Time : Block out dedicated time in your daily schedule for reading, just as you would for a meeting or appointment. Consistency helps reinforce the habit.
  • Engage with Quality Content : Seek out high-quality articles, essays, or books that challenge your thinking and broaden your perspectives. Platforms like Medium, academic journals, or curated newsletters can offer valuable content that encourages active engagement.

Connect with Others

Reading doesn't have to be a solitary activity. Engaging with a community can enhance your experience and motivate you to read more actively:

  • Join a Book Club : Participating in a book club provides opportunities to discuss ideas and perspectives with others, enriching your understanding of the material.
  • Use Social Media Positively : Follow accounts that promote reading and share insightful content. Engage in discussions about books or articles to create an active dialogue around reading.

Be Patient and Flexible

Finally, remember that transitioning from passive scrolling to active reading is a process that takes time:

  • Embrace Imperfection: It's okay to have days when you don't feel like reading or when you get distracted. Be kind to yourself and view setbacks as part of the learning curve.
  • Adjust as Needed : If a particular approach isn't working, don't hesitate to try something new. Experiment with different formats, genres, or reading environments to find what resonates best with you.

Conclusion

Breaking free from the cycle of passive scrolling and cultivating an active reading habit in the digital age is not only possible but incredibly rewarding. By identifying your motivations, setting clear goals, creating a conducive environment, and engaging with material actively, you can transform your relationship with reading. Embrace this journey, and enjoy the wealth of knowledge and insights that await you in the world of books and articles!
